Re-Registration with the National Medical Register: What Every Doctor Needs to Know

The National Medical Commission (NMC) has recently introduced the National Medical Register (NMR), a significant development aimed at enhancing the transparency and accuracy of the medical profession in India. The National Task Force: Paving the Way for Safer and Dignified Working Conditions for Medical Professionals

In a significant move aimed at enhancing the safety, well-being, and working conditions of medical professionals across India, the Supreme Court has constituted a National Task Force (NTF) to address pressing issues in the healthcare sector.
